It's not just Nexus 4 It runs on Nexus 5, Nexus 7, (OPX has some problems but i believe it's some library issues) maybe it will run on some other ports too if modified correctly. sadly i can't test it. I have only N4 & N5 and i can confirm this works on both of them. On N4 i even have play store and play services
Now about second rpm (link down below) this should help you install google services and play store. after installing this rpm you will see 4 apks in your home folder: google.apk, google_services.apk, play_store.apk and youtube.apk. Go ahead and install them. You should see them in your menu. now run them and confirm if it works.
